Description
Due to the introduction of molecular and cellular biology approaches, our understanding of ovarian physiology has reached a new level during the last few years. The present volume provides a new perspective on the ovary from molecular and cellular to whole organ levels, from non-mammalian and rodent to human levels and from paracrine, neuroendocrine and endocrine levels as well. These papers represent the proceedings of the Ninth Ovarian Workshop sponsored by Serono Symposia, USA, July 9-11, 1992 in Chapel Hill, North Carolina.
